Goorn, Fair Isle, Shetland.
| NGR: | HZ 22223 71588 |
| WGS84: | 59.52964, -1.60892 |
| Length: | 30 m |
| Vert. Range: | 12 m |
| Altitude: | -3 m |
| Geology: | Observatory Sandstone Formation - argillaceous rock, dolomitic |
| Tags: | Cave, Arch, SeaCave |
| Registry: | main |
'Entered by snorkeller 19/8/21. Large entrance, ~5 m wide at waterline but narrowing above and ceiling estimated ~9 m ACD becoming lower within the cave (~2 m ACD at back). Cave width becomes narrower within entrance and at ~20 m within cave it becomes abruptly narrower to <1 m in width. Floor at ~ 3 m BCD at entrance, shallowing to <0 m ACD at back of cave. Passage length estimated at ~30 m. Dark at back of cave. Noted Alcyonium, barnacles & bryozoan crusts.' [Report 1145]
Alternative Names: CI25, Goorn Natural Arch (North-west)
Notes: Dimensions are estimates.
